> > I'll let Takashi decide whether to take this or not as I no longer care
> > about this code, but IMHO this changes is completely pointless since you
> > don't also clean up the code to have a common prefix with #define pr_fmt
> > and then clean up the callers etc.
> > 
> i mentioned in the comment that in a future patch we can have pr_fmt,
> it was not done in this patch since the changes for this patch is
> generated by a script and not manually.
> if Takashi accepts this then the next patch will have pr_fmt.

If you're going to work on it, please give a patch series and let me
merge once.  There is no good merit to merge a half-baked piece by
piece.

Regarding the changes you've made: so far, I've merged two such
patches just because it's a good exercise for newbies.  You've played
it and experienced it enough.  So it's time to go up to a higher
stage, more "real" fixes.

For example, if you are still interested in printk stuff, try to
change the calls to dev_err() and co.  Of course, this needs more
understanding of the code you'll handle, which object is passed for
which messages.
